Apparently the BMW i folks decided that their gussometer is so accurate (taking traffic, changes in elevation, etc.) that they have decided to remove the SOC that has been so prominent in the Active E. I believe that this is a glaring error on their part. This algorithm is very good at predicting using past data that it does not take into account multiple driver families. As often as I am the driver of a particular vehicle, I share all our vehicles with my better half and she drives differently than I do. I use the SOC to calculate for myself whether my aggressive driving style will need to be adjusted during my commute. The guessometer does not take that into consideration. Put the SOC back in and that should fix it. Additionally, use the keys to determine which driver is using the vehicle. The Guessometer should log my driving style for MY keys and log my wife’s driving style for HER key. Just a thought.

After over 21 months of EV driving and meticulous postings of my electric mileage, it’s finally happened. Sometime in the past few weeks I’ve passed 50,000 all electric miles of driving!

I would have been more precise, however. Sharing EVs with my wife, I can’t tell which are her driving miles versus my driving miles. I do know that I drive 95-98% of the time, so I can claim most of the miles.

So… What does that mean… Well, I’ve calculated a cost of approximately $0.008 per mile since I’ve moved to Solar power on my roof. Well, let’s assume that with the addition of the Tesla Roadster and Model S to the fleet, my costs have gone up to $0.012 per mile. I’m using this figure because both the Roadster and Model S exhibits more Vampire Drain (defined as the energy consumed by the EV while idle) than the Active E has in its approximately 48,000 miles of service. So, using this figure, let’s say that we’ve spent approximately $600 during these 50,000 miles. Well, I’ve used paid EV Charging Networks as well. Not too often, but enough to approximate an additonal $50, let’s double this figure to be really conservative. So, we’re talking $700 for the 50,000 miles. Now, if we had driven all those miles in our least expensive ICE (Internal Combustion Engine (gasoline engine)) car was at $0.15 per mile. These same miles would have been $7,500 in energy costs.

So, I guess after 50,000 miles, I have at least $6,800 to be thankful for.

The importance of Telematics…

After over twenty months of driving electric vehicles (EVs). I was thinking of advantages that EVs have over internal combustion engine (ICE) cars.

One of the things that I feel is critical to have in a production Electric Vehicle is proper telematics. Telematics is the intersection of telecommunications and information. The ability to monitor and get feedback as to the status of the vehicle is a feature that I think should be supported by all EVs.

What are some baseline features of Telematics that I would like to see from EV manufacturers.

1) Support for Multiple Mobile devices as well as the Web.

2) Near real-time status updates of the vehicle and its current state.
A) Battery Charge Level
B) Charging/Not Charging (Plugged/Not Plugged)
C) Estimate of how long charging will take

3) At least several years of access to the systems should be included with the price of the car.

First, the My BMW Remote Application and Active E.

1) BMW has an application for iOS and Android. No access via the web or Blackberry.

2) Near real-time status updates of the vehicle and its current state.
the My BMW Remote provides good feedback of this status on the iPod Touch version by giving the user the “Status from: Date and Time” on the upper right of the application. The iPad version only gives the “Status from: Date” on the same location. It makes the iPod Touch version an edge even between the same mobile OS.

As above, the iPod version

IMG_3076

and the iPad version [NOTE: I edited out the map on the left corner for the location]

IMG_1945

A) Battery Charge Level

BMW does provide this, but it’s been somewhat unreliable. For example, most recently, I was unable to get any of this status on the iOS application from October 23, 2013 to October 29, 2013. It finally started working again.

if the status is frozen, have to hit the refresh button to get a refresh. And it’s hit or miss whether that works.

B) Charging/Not Charging (Plugged/Not Plugged)

The My BMW Remote does show this status and enable one to change the scheduled time of charge as well as initiate a charge directly. It also monitors whether or not the car is plugged in at the location.

C) Estimate of how long charging will take

The My BMW Remote does a good job of providing this feedback in the same manner as the vehicle does as far as when it expects to complete the charge to 100%. It Actually provides the hour:minute estimate of how much time is left to complete the charge. However, this algorithm is actually toward 99% charge and not full stop as the slow down for the last few minutes can last a while if the user wants to unplug when the car is completely stopped its charge.

3) At least several years of access to the systems should be included with the price of the car.

This is not an issue on the Active E as the close end lease from BMW will run out before access to these systems are in place.

Third, CarWings and Nissan Leaf.

1) Support for Multiple Mobile devices as well as the Web.

Carwings is deployed on iOS, Android, AND Blackberry. It’s kind of cool in that. However, the command structure seems to employ either SMS or a query/response system between the user App, a server, and finally the vehicle.

2) Near real-time status updates of the vehicle and its current state.

IMG_3096

As a result of this query system, one must be cognizant of the Updated field in the middle of the application to see when the status was polled from the vehicle.

If you do not set the Application for auto-poll at start up, you need to initiate one.

IMG_3101

IMG_3099

Then wait for the response to get the update.

IMG_3103

IMG_3104

A) Battery Charge Level
B) Charging/Not Charging (Plugged/Not Plugged)
C) Estimate of how long charging will take

Aside from the pause, stop, start, nature of a manually requested polling system, the Leaf and Carwings knock A – C out of the park. It gives a status on what speed the vehicle is charging at, an estimate of how long it will take to charge over differing conditions, it lets you know easily whether the car is plugged in or not, whether it is charging, or not, etc.

3) At least several years of access to the systems should be included with the price of the car.

At time of lease (this is my mom’s vehicle that we’re reviewing.) CarWings was included for three years. Nissan has announced that European ones will be free past their initial period, I have not really paid attention to the US Nissan program, so I really shouldn’t comment on that.

I really enjoy the configurations for Carwings to NOTIFY the user via email and text messaging of the charge status whether the charge was interrupted or not. Additionally, the user can configure the vehicle to recognize (via GPS) when the vehicle is near a preferred parking location that it should plug in at. For example, since my mother is >60 years old, we have it set to notify her (and me) when she’s home and forgot to plug in.

This particular feature combined with the stopped charging notifications that we set up on the car enabled me to remotely diagnose when my mother’s 2013 Nissan Leaf started to exhibit the 6.6kw charger problems that was reported with earlier batches of the vehicle. This then enabled her to take the time to get the vehicle back to Nissan for service.

My mother loves the ability to remotely engage the cooling (warming) features of CarWings so that she can initiate cabin control when she is a few minutes away from her vehicle.
